I have some formulas set up in a spreadsheet that other people will fill
progressively. In cells where the formula has no feeder' data to provide a result it displays 1". Cell A1= 1(month from B1) correct Cell B1= 1/2/06 Here is the formula i am using in Cell A1 =Month(B1) when i copied my formula down it does pick up the right month(1,2,3 etc) however when i copied it down to where there were no dates the result for all of them were 1. I do not want anything in that cell. i hope i explained this right. thanks -- Message posted via http://www.officekb.com |

Try:
=IF(B1="","",Month(B1)) Regards Trevor "Darts via OfficeKB.com" <u19990@uwe wrote in message news:5dcd0a3f610b3@uwe... You said:
Cell A1 = 1(month from B1) correct Cell B1 = 1/2/06 Hence, the formula for cell A1 to cope with cell B1 being blank is: =IF(B1="","",Month(B1)) If Cell A2 relates to cell B2, as I assume it does, then the formula for A2 would be: =IF(B2="","",Month(B2)) And so on. You can AutoFill the formula down the column or just copy and paste and the formula will adjust. So: A3 =IF(B3="","",Month(B3)) A4 =IF(B4="","",Month(B4)) A5 =IF(B5="","",Month(B5)) Maybe I have misunderstood what you are trying to achieve Regards Trevor "Darts via OfficeKB.com" <u19990@uwe wrote in message news:5dcd9d1228dc8@uwe...
